What Features Should You Consider When Choosing a Battery Operated Lawn Blower?

When selecting the best battery operated lawn blower, various features can significantly impact performance and usability.

  • Battery Life: Look for a blower with a long-lasting battery to ensure you can complete your yard work without frequent recharges. A robust battery typically offers runtime between 30 to 60 minutes, depending on the power settings used.
  • Motor Power: The motor’s power, measured in volts, directly influences the blower’s performance. Higher voltage motors tend to provide more airflow and suction, making it easier to clear leaves and debris quickly.
  • Airflow Speed: The maximum airflow speed, measured in miles per hour (MPH), determines how effectively the blower can move leaves and debris. A blower with a higher MPH rating can tackle tough jobs in less time.
  • Weight and Ergonomics: Consider the weight of the blower, as a lightweight model will be easier to handle and maneuver, especially during extended use. Ergonomic designs can reduce strain on your hands and back, enhancing comfort while working.
  • Noise Level: Battery operated blowers are generally quieter than gas models, but some still produce noticeable noise. Look for models with lower decibel ratings for a more peaceful yard care experience, especially in residential areas.
  • Versatility and Features: Some blowers come with additional features such as vacuum or mulching capabilities, which can be beneficial for yard maintenance. Check for adjustable speed settings and nozzle attachments that can enhance versatility for different tasks.
  • Charging Time: The time it takes to recharge the battery can affect your workflow. Opt for a model with a fast charging time, allowing you to return to work quickly after the battery runs out.
  • Build Quality and Warranty: A durable build ensures longevity and reliable performance. Additionally, a good warranty can provide peace of mind against defects and issues that may arise over time.

How Do Battery Life and Recharge Time Impact Performance?

Battery life and recharge time are critical factors that directly influence the performance of battery-operated lawn blowers. Understanding these aspects helps users select a model that meets their specific needs.

  • Battery Life: This defines how long the blower can operate on a single charge. Models with high-capacity batteries (typically measured in amp-hours) can run longer, which is crucial for larger tasks. While some blowers may operate for 30-45 minutes, heavy-duty models can last over an hour. Consider your yard size; larger areas may require blowers with extended battery life.

  • Recharge Time: This indicates how quickly the battery can be recharged after use. Most blowers recharge within 1-4 hours. Quick recharge models allow users to complete multiple tasks in one session without significant downtime. Fast charging technology is increasingly common, providing a full charge in under an hour for convenience.

Choosing a blower with an optimal balance of battery life and recharge time based on the size of your yard and frequency of use can significantly enhance efficiency and productivity during lawn maintenance tasks.

How Does Weight and Design Affect Usability?

  • Weight: The weight of a battery-operated lawn blower directly impacts how easy it is to handle and operate, especially during extended use. A lighter blower reduces user fatigue and allows for greater control, making it easier to maneuver around gardens or tight spaces.
  • Design Ergonomics: An ergonomic design ensures that the blower fits comfortably in the user’s hands, with grips that prevent slipping and reduce strain. Features like adjustable handles or padded grips can enhance comfort during prolonged use, making tasks more manageable.
  • Balance: A well-balanced lawn blower distributes its weight evenly, allowing for less effort in maintaining control while in operation. Proper balance minimizes the physical strain on the user and increases accuracy when directing airflow.
  • Size and Portability: The size of the blower affects its portability; compact models are easier to store and transport. A smaller design can be particularly beneficial for users with limited storage space or those who need to carry the blower over uneven terrain.
  • Nozzle Design: The design of the blower’s nozzle affects its efficiency and usability. A nozzle that can be easily adjusted or swapped out for different tasks allows users to optimize performance for various debris types, enhancing versatility.

How Do Battery Operated Blowers Compare to Gas-Powered Options?

Feature Battery Operated Blowers Gas-Powered Blowers
Power Source Powered by rechargeable batteries, offering convenience and no emissions. Run on gasoline, providing higher power output but producing emissions.
Weight Generally lighter, making them easier to maneuver and carry. Often heavier due to the engine and fuel components, which can make them cumbersome.
Noise Level Quieter operation, suitable for residential areas without disturbing neighbors. Typically louder, which may be disruptive in quiet neighborhoods.
Running Time Limited by battery life, requiring recharging or replacement for prolonged use. Can run as long as there is fuel, allowing for extended usage without interruptions.
Cost Generally more affordable upfront, but battery replacement costs can add up. Higher initial cost, but no battery replacement needed, only fuel.
Maintenance Low maintenance; mainly battery care and occasional cleaning. Higher maintenance required, including fuel system upkeep and oil changes.
Environmental Impact No emissions, but battery production has environmental concerns; quieter operation helps reduce noise pollution. Produces emissions and contributes to noise pollution, impacting the environment.
Performance on Debris Effective on light debris like grass clippings and dry leaves; may struggle with wet leaves or heavy debris. Powerful performance on all types of debris, including wet leaves and heavy material.

How Can You Maintain Your Battery Operated Lawn Blower for Longevity?

To ensure the longevity of your battery-operated lawn blower, consider the following maintenance tips:

  • Regular Cleaning: Keep the blower free of debris and dirt to maintain optimal performance.
  • Battery Care: Properly manage the battery’s charge cycles to extend its lifespan.
  • Storage Conditions: Store the blower in a cool, dry place to prevent damage from extreme temperatures.
  • Inspecting Parts: Regularly check for any signs of wear or damage on components like the nozzle and housing.
  • Software Updates: If applicable, keep the blower’s software up to date for improved efficiency and functionality.

Regular Cleaning: After each use, remove leaves, dirt, and other debris from the blower’s exterior and intake vents. This not only helps prevent blockages that can affect performance but also reduces the risk of overheating.

Battery Care: Charge the battery fully before storing it and avoid letting it fully discharge frequently. Lithium-ion batteries, common in battery-operated blowers, perform better and last longer when they are kept between 20% and 80% charge.

Storage Conditions: Extreme temperatures can degrade battery performance and the blower’s plastic components. It’s best to keep the blower in a garage or shed that is climate-controlled or at least shielded from direct sunlight and frost.

Inspecting Parts: Periodically check the blower for any cracks, loose screws, or damaged parts that may need repair or replacement. Addressing these issues early can prevent more significant damage and ensure the blower operates efficiently.

Software Updates: Some newer models may have firmware that can be updated. Check the manufacturer’s website for any available updates that could enhance performance, battery management, or safety features.

What Common Issues Can Arise with Battery Operated Lawn Blowers and How Can You Troubleshoot Them?

Common issues with battery-operated lawn blowers can affect their efficiency and performance; here are some of the most prevalent problems and troubleshooting tips.

  • Battery Not Charging: If the battery is not charging, check the charger and connections to ensure they are functioning properly. Sometimes dust or debris can accumulate in the charging port, preventing a good connection, so clean it gently before retrying.
  • Insufficient Power Output: If the blower is running but lacks power, it could be due to a weak or aging battery. Regularly inspect the battery for signs of wear and consider replacing it if it no longer holds a charge effectively.
  • Overheating: Overheating can occur if the blower is used for extended periods without breaks. Allow the blower to cool down and ensure that the vents are not blocked by debris or dust which can restrict airflow.
  • Motor Issues: If the motor is not running smoothly or making unusual noises, this could indicate internal damage. Check for any obstructions in the blower tube and consult the manufacturer’s manual for guidance on maintenance and repairs.
  • Intermittent Operation: If the blower works sporadically, it could be due to a loose connection or a faulty switch. Inspect the power switch and wiring for any signs of damage and ensure all connections are secure.
  • Debris Clogging: A common issue is debris clogging the blower tube, which can hinder performance. Regularly check and clean the tube to prevent blockages and maintain optimal airflow during operation.
